Shostakovich, Nos, Mariinsky company at the Opera Bastille, 19 November 2005 -- the last night of the run and the source of the France Musique relay. Run dates confirmed outside the folder by the ConcertoNet review of the premiere, http://www.concertonet.com/scripts/review.php?ID_review=3206 ("Paris, Opera Bastille, 11/14/2005 - et 15, 17, 18, 19 novembre 2005"), and by the house production page saved with the files (operadeparis.fr/Saison0506/spectacle.asp?Id=857), which also prints "Ce spectacle sera retransmis par France Musique"; the 14 November in-house sheet in the sibling folder adds "One of the performances will be broadcast by France Musique on December 10". The night itself rests on the compiler sheet distributed with this capture, in the folder as "Chostakovitch-NOS-Paris 19 November 2005-Cast.txt", headed "Paris, Opera Bastille / 19 November 2005" -- the Paris Opera publishes no historical performance database and operadis carries no entry for this run, so no archive corroborates the day. What IS established outside the sheet is that this is not the 14th: measured against the 14 November in-house tape (self-test, three controls and two negative controls in one run) it shows no lock at any lag or speed, exactly like a known-different pair, where a known one-night/two-capture control locked. Cast per the sheet, which differs from the 14 November sheet in six roles. Its District Constable ("Yuri Popov") is left unrecorded: it is one letter-set away from the Andrey Popov of the premiere sheet and nothing corroborates a second Popov.
